With various organizations, universities, and government bodies offering fully funded undergraduate scholarships, students have the chance to study at prestigious institutions without the burden of tuition fees and other expenses.
These scholarships cover not only tuition fees but also accommodation, books, and sometimes even travel expenses, making it possible for students from diverse backgrounds to access education without financial constraints. By removing the financial barriers to higher education, fully funded scholarships play a vital role in promoting inclusivity and diversity in academic settings. Students who may have otherwise been unable to afford a college education can now pursue their academic goals and contribute to their communities and societies.
